Demand for campus housing is still growing, so Indiana Tech will build its eighth residence hall in 2012. This will be the fifth consecutive year that the university has constructed a residence hall to accommodate the growth, and the project will bring the total campus housing capacity to 610.

Each suite in the three-story residence hall will house two students and will include a bedroom and bathroom. The two-story lobby area will include a fireplace and other spaces for students to gather, and the building will have laundry facilities and vending machines.

The estimated cost of the project is $4.3 million, and construction began in February. The residence hall will be completed in July, with students moving in at the beginning of August. Volume 8, Issue 2
